Embodiment 1

[0021] Embodiment 1: a kind of formaldehyde scavenger is to prepare with gelatin as raw material, and described preparation process comprises the following steps successively,

[0022] Step 1: gelatin is hydrolyzed: prepare a gelatin solution with a mass concentration of 20%, adjust the pH to 8.5 with 20% diethanolamine aqueous solution, then add 0.3% alkaline protease (based on the mass of gelatin), heat up to 60°C, After reacting for 2 hours, raise the temperature to 100°C to inactivate the enzyme, and remove a small amount of impurities in a centrifuge to obtain gelatin hydrolyzate. This step exposes the gelatin to more amino and carboxyl groups.

Embodiment 2

[0025] Embodiment 2: a kind of formaldehyde scavenger is to prepare with gelatin as raw material, and described preparation process comprises the following steps successively,

[0026] Step 1: gelatin is hydrolyzed: prepare a gelatin solution with a mass concentration of 50%, adjust the pH to 8.0 with 30% diethanolamine aqueous solution, then add 1.5% alkaline protease (based on the mass of gelatin), heat up to 40°C, After reacting for 6 hours, raise the temperature to 90°C to inactivate the enzyme, and remove a small amount of impurities in a centrifuge to obtain gelatin hydrolyzate;

Abstract

The invention relates to the technical field of environment-friendly products, in particular to a formaldehyde scavenger and a preparation method thereof. The invention aims to solve the problems that the prior art is of high volatility, produces pungent odor, causes secondary damages to a human body, and is unsuitable for widespread utilization. In order to overcome the problems of the prior art, the technical scheme of the invention includes using gelatin which is taken as the raw material to prepare and obtain a formaldehyde scavenger. The preparation process comprises the following steps in sequence: step one, subjecting the gelatin to hydration; step two, preparing and obtaining aminated gelatin by subjecting gelatin digest to amino derivation modification; and step three, obtaining the formaldehyde scavenger by re-compounding the aminated gelatin obtained from the first step with amino-terminated hyper-branched polymer and chitosan according to the mass ratio of 0.8-1:0.8-1:0.8-1.

Technical field: [0001] The invention relates to the technical field of environmental protection products, in particular to a formaldehyde scavenger and a preparation method thereof. Background technique: [0002] Formaldehyde is an important basic organic chemical raw material, which is widely used in pesticides (herbicides, insecticides, fungicides and fumigants), medicines (disinfection of medical and sanitation and production of some medicines), coatings, resins, papermaking, etc. With the improvement of living standards, interior decoration is in the ascendant, and formaldehyde, as an "invisible killer", has also entered people's living and working places. When the formaldehyde concentration is higher than 1mg / kg, it will cause harm to the human body.
